    Yes, the angle of the A-pillar is different because they have different bodies, the 4er is lower by 2.7in/6.86cm (talking about the F32 gen, but the difference remains on the G22). Plus, the 4-Series has frameless glass panes on the doors while the 3er doesn't. It's always been that way ever since the E36.
